Name        : ClanLib06
Product     : Fedora 8
Version     : 0.6.5
Release     : 12.fc8
URL         : http://www.clanlib.org/
Summary     : Version 0.6 of this Cross platform C++ game library
Description :
Version 0.6 of this cross platform C++ game library, which is still used
by many games.

--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Update Information:

Add support for audio output through alsa (original ClanLib only supports
OSS??), this also adds support for using pulseaudio through alsa.

ChangeLog:

* Sun Mar  2 2008 Hans de Goede <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> 0.6.5-12
- Add support for audio output through alsa (original ClanLib only supports
  OSS??), this also adds support for using pulseaudio through alsa
* Sun Feb 17 2008 Hans de Goede <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> 0.6.5-11
- Rebuild for new libmikmod
- Rebuild with gcc 4.3
* Fri Jan  4 2008 Hans de Goede <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> 0.6.5-10
- Fix building with gcc 4.3
* Sun Oct 21 2007 Hans de Goede <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> 0.6.5-9
- Explictily disable directfb support, so that it doesn't accidentally get
  build on system which have directfb installed
- Fix multilib conflict in the Reference documentation (bz 340861)
